Yes, you can get a ferry from Mallaig to 2 ferry ports. Ferries from Mallaig are operated by 1 ferry company; Caledonian MacBrayne. There are currently 9 daily and 64 weekly sailings from Mallaig.
Mallaig ferries sail to 2 ferry ports. These ferry ports include Armadale & Lochboisdale.
The duration of the Mallaig ferry depends which route you take. Ferries from Mallaig range between 30 minutes and 3 hours 30 minutes. Bear in mind that Mallaig ferry times can change from season to season so it's best to check the latest Mallaig ferry timetable before you book.
The fastest ferry from Mallaig is to Armadale, with a duration of around 30 minutes.

Mallaig and its port have a long history, with the town’s name originating from the Old Norse meaning for ‘Bay of the Seabirds’. Set in stunning surroundings, the local railway station is the terminus of the West Highland Line which was used in the ‘Harry Potter’ films as the Hogwarts Express railway line. The port of Mallaig is situated at the northern end of the A380, known as ‘the Road to the Isles’, and provides frequent sailings to Armadale on the Isle of Skye. Free car parking is available outside the terminal building and the nearest bus stop is just a five-minute walk away. Inside the building, you’ll find a seated waiting area with toilet facilities.
